Background technology
Compressor of air conditioner makes to play compressible drive refrigerant in air conditioning coolant loop, and refrigerant can pass through object State variation come absorb or discharge heat with this come have the function that adjust temperature, compressor of air conditioner by the driving of power-equipment come The volume for changing refrigerant, compresses refrigerant and is conveyed.
In the prior art, the air-conditioning refrigeration system in most of vehicles all uses driven by engine compressor operating, when In order to save open air-conditioning system consumed the energy when, technical staff can reduce the idling of engine, at this time engine cylinder Interior gas load can change, and cause the unbalanced power in cylinder, and each piston can be caused in working stroke Horizontal direction component is inconsistent, the moment unbalance that engine can be made laterally to shake down, so as to cause the shake of engine.In addition to hair Motivation is transmitted to the vibration on compressor of air conditioner by transmission device, and compressor of air conditioner is compressing refrigerant and conveying In the process, corresponding vibration is also will produce, these vibrations pass to interior driver and passenger by vehicle frame, influence body of riding It tests, in addition these vibrations also will produce noise, reduce the comfort level of occupant.
In order to carry out vibration damping to compressor of air conditioner, the method for technical staff's generally use vibration insulation and noise reduction is come to vibration and noise It is controlled, Authorization Notice No. CN202301738U, authorized announcement date is that the Chinese patent of 2012.07.04 discloses one kind Compressor of air conditioner damping frame and the air-conditioned passenger train for using the damping frame, damping frame therein includes for installing air-conditioning pressure The bearing of contracting machine and motor and the vibration isolation support seat for being arranged on vehicle frame, bearing is by shaft rolling assembling in vibration isolation branch It supports on seat, vibration isolation support seat includes rubber block and the fixed axis being rotatably assorted with shaft being arranged in rubber block Set, one end of bearing are equipped with the elastic limit device that bidirectionally limited buffering is carried out to bearing, and concrete structure is that one end is hinged on vehicle Gag lever post on frame, gag lever post can be slidably matched when bearing is rotated with bearing, and in the both sides up and down of gag lever post It is arranged with the upper and lower compression spring coordinated with bearing top pressure respectively.When the vibration of horizontal direction and vertical direction occurs in compressor of air conditioner When, the rotation of bearing can be caused, and bearing rotation can offset the vibration of the vertical direction of a part, at this time compression spring and lower compression spring Can carry out limiting buffer to bearing, vibration isolation support seat and rubber block therein can the vibration of level of isolation direction and remaining Vertical direction vibrates, final to reduce the vibration and the noise as caused by vibrating that compressor of air conditioner transmits outward.
But there are problems in above-mentioned patent:When stating the damping frame in patent in use, damping frame is certainly After the fixation, intrinsic frequency is also determined body structure, when vehicle idling changes, the excitation suffered by damping frame Frequency can change with idling speed, when this driving frequency moves closer to the intrinsic frequency of damping frame, damping frame Amplitude can significantly increase, most intuitive performance is become larger by the vibration that damping frame transmits outward, can be in damping frame Inside generates dynamic stress, keeps the parts forced vibration in damping frame, effectiveness in vibration suppression poor.So while the influence of structure, Damping frame applicability in above-mentioned patent is not good enough, and the operating mode that can stablize vibration damping is few.

Specific implementation mode
As shown in Figure 1, to use the embodiment of the vehicle of damping frame in the utility model:Vehicle includes vehicle frame, in vehicle It is provided in frame to compressor of air conditioner 11, compressor of air conditioner 11 is connected with engine 12 by belt pulley, and is set on vehicle frame There is the damping frame that vibration damping is carried out to compressor of air conditioner 11.Damping frame includes the bearing 1 for carrying compressor of air conditioner 11.Branch Seat 1 is inverted triangle structure, and the middle part of bearing 1 is hinged with rotation seat, and bearing 1 can be rotated around rotation seat.Rotation seat includes U-shaped The peripheral surface of skeleton, skeleton is enclosed with rubber pad 10, filled with the supporting block 8 for capableing of absorbing vibration damping in skeleton, in rotation seat It is interior equipped with through-hole and the shaft 13 that is plugged in through-hole, axle sleeve 9 is equipped between shaft 13 and the through-hole of rotation seat.
The both sides of bearing 1 are provided with the identical pneumatic support seat of structure, pneumatic support seat includes the spring being vertically arranged Cylinder 3, be provided in spring strut 3 with spring strut 3 be oriented to cooperation piston rod 2, piston rod 2 can pushing tow bearing 1, piston rod 2 3 inner space of spring strut is separated into a rod chamber and rodless cavity by the piston of lower part, and the bottom lock of rodless cavity becomes One space that can be connected to pressure medium.The top of spring strut 3 is provided with inward flange, inward flange can be with the work of piston rod Beyond the Great Wall end face block coordinate, so that the stroke of piston rod is restricted, spring strut 3 be additionally provided with to the piston on piston rod 2 into The spring 4 of row pushing tow.It is connected with gas bag 6 in the bottom of spring strut 3, gas bag 6 can be that sufficient air source is provided in spring strut 3, Piston rod 2 is driven to be moved up and down in spring strut 3.Control gas path on-off is provided in the gas circuit that gas bag 6 is connect with spring strut 3 Switch 7, the barometer 5 of atmospheric pressure value in capable of showing gas circuit is provided between the external interface of switch 7 and spring strut 3.
In technical staff using the damping frame in the utility model come when compressor of air conditioner is adjusted, damping frame In supporting block 8 and rubber pad 10 can reduce the vibration that compressor of air conditioner 11 is transmitted on vehicle frame, and to branch in damping frame There are two different working conditions for the tool of piston rod 2 that seat 1 is supported, and can absorb air-conditioning pressure in unpressurized spring 4 The vibration that contracting machine 11 generates, piston rod 2 can receive pressure and push upward pushing tow bearing 1, can increase what damping frame was applicable in Range.When the vibration of horizontal direction and vertical direction occurs in compressor of air conditioner 11, the rotation of bearing 1, bearing 1 can be caused to rotate The vibration that a part of vertical direction can be balanced out, the vibration being transmitted on piston rod 2 by bearing 1 can drive piston rod 2 to act, this When piston rod 2 be in servo-actuated state, can be tension or in compression.Piston rod 2 action drive 4 deformation of spring, 4 deformation of spring by this It is converted into mechanical energy and interior energy, reduces the vibration that bearing transmits outward.
When the idling of vehicle changes, 11 He of compressor of air conditioner is transmitted in engine 12 suffered by damping frame The vibration frequency that compressor of air conditioner 11 itself generates can change, when intrinsic frequency of the driving frequency close to damping frame, Damping frame can resonate with compressor of air conditioner 11, therefore technical staff carrys out regulating piston bar when damping frame is shaken 2, piston rod 2 is pushed using air pressure to carry out rigid support to the bearing 1 in damping frame.
The switch 7 in gas circuit is opened at this time, and switch 7 has been connected to the bottom of gas bag and spring strut 3, due to piston rod 2 and bullet Spring cylinder 3 coordinates preferably, and a pressure space can be provided for gas, and the air pressure of 3 lower half of spring strut at this time is got higher, and air pressure pushes Piston moves up, 2 upward pushing tow bearing 1 of piston rod, and bearing 1 is vibrated when rotating down, can be by the support of piston rod 2 Power makes the rigidity of bearing 1 get higher.So that the intrinsic frequency of entire damping frame is changed by changing the rigidity of bearing 1, keeps away Exempt from damping frame to resonate with compressor of air conditioner 11, the vibration of compressor of air conditioner 11 is passed on vehicle frame.
If satisfied effectiveness in vibration suppression cannot still be obtained by reaching maximum to the air pressure being filled in spring strut 3, technical staff can be with It turns off the switch, deflates to the gas of rodless cavity in spring strut 3, the survival gas and spring 4 in spring strut 3 can integrate work With ejector piston, until reaching satisfied vibrating effect, then the air pressure including spring strut 3 is constant, enables piston rod 2 It keeps acting on the rigid support of bearing 1, technical staff can observe the reading of barometer 5 to keep the air pressure of spring strut 3.
